According to church tradition, June 29 marks the martyrdom of the Apostle Paul. In recent years, Voice of the Martyrs has been encouraging Christians to take time on this day to honor the legacy of those who have sacrificed their lives for the advance of the gospel.
This year they are telling the story of John Chau, killed by the Sentinelese people, who had little or no previous contact with outsiders and had responded to previous attempts with violence.
